MU lands shooting guard
By Michael Hunt of the Journal Sentinel Oct. 12, 2013 8:10 p.m.

Ahmed Hill, a 6-foot-5 senior shooting guard from Aquinas High School in Augusta, Ga., has given his verbal commitment to play for Marquette next season.

"I will be a Golden Eagle next year at Marquette University!!" he said on Twitter. "Thank you God for blessing me and my family with this opportunity."

Hill averaged 33 points a game last season as a junior and has scored more than 2,000 points. He was offered scholarships by Missouri, Indiana, Florida State and Florida. It is another major coup for Marquette coach Buzz Williams, who reeled in one of the nation's top recruiting classes for 2013.

A natural shooting guard, Hill should fit right in at Marquette with his rangy, athletic style of play. Even with consecutive seasons in the Sweet 16 and the Elite 8, the Golden Eagles have lacked shooters. Depending on how he develops, HIll could be what they've needed at the two-guard position.
